Subject: Re: 2.6.28.[45] boot failure: request_module: runaway loop modprobe
 binfmt-464c

On Tue, 17 Feb 2009 11:01:51 +0100, Kay Sievers wrote:
> On Tue, Feb 17, 2009 at 10:09, Tilman Schmidt <tilman@...p.cc> wrote:
>> My workhorse machine (Pentium D 940, Intel DG965QF board,
>> mirrored SATA disks), which runs fine with kernel:
>> ts@...on:~> uname -a
>> Linux xenon 2.6.28.3-testing #1 SMP PREEMPT Mon Feb 2 23:32:07 CET 2009 i686 i686 i386 GNU/Linux
>> fails to come up with an identically configured 2.6.28.4 or 2.6.28.5
>> kernel. [...]
> 
> Are you sure, that you don't have a 32/64 bit mismatch between the
> kernel and userspace? Like you miss 32-bit emulation in a 64-bit
> kernel, or your modprobe is 64-bit and you are trying to run it on a
> 32-bit kernel?

Pretty sure. Although running on a 64 bit capable processor, this
is a pure 32 bit installation:

ts@...on:~> file /sbin/modprobe
/sbin/modprobe: ELF 32-bit LSB executable, Intel 80386, version 1 (SYSV), for GNU/Linux 2.6.4, dynamically linked (uses shared libs), stripped
ts@...on:~> uname -a
Linux xenon 2.6.28.3-testing #1 SMP PREEMPT Mon Feb 2 23:32:07 CET 2009 i686 i686 i386 GNU/Linux
ts@...on:~> diff kernel/linux-2.6.28.{3,5}-work/.config
3,4c3,4
< # Linux kernel version: 2.6.28.3
< # Mon Feb  2 22:41:42 2009
---
> # Linux kernel version: 2.6.28.5
> # Sat Feb 14 00:06:09 2009
ts@...on:~> file /boot/vmlinuz-2.6.28.*
/boot/vmlinuz-2.6.28.3-testing: Linux/x86 Kernel, Setup Version 0x209, bzImage, Version 2.6.28.3, RO-rootFS, swap_dev 0x2, Normal VGA
/boot/vmlinuz-2.6.28.5-testing: Linux/x86 Kernel, Setup Version 0x209, bzImage, Version 2.6.28.5, RO-rootFS, swap_dev 0x2, Normal VGA
ts@...on:~>

The first one of these two kernels runs fine, the second one hangs.
